Three temperature records recorded in Kyiv: weather resembles early April

Three temperature records were set in Kyiv on January 30 – minimum, maximum and average daily temperatures. According to the Borys Sreznevsky Central Geophysical Observatory, the weather indicators exceeded the previous records from 2002 and correspond to typical temperatures for early April.

The minimum air temperature did not drop below 3.0°C, which is 0.1°C higher than the previous record for this date in 2002.

The maximum air temperature after noon reached 11.6 °C, which is 3.7 °C higher than in the same year 2002.

The average daily air temperature was the highest during the observations for this date and was 6.5°C, which exceeded the previous record of 2002 by 1.4°C, and the climatic norm by 10.7°C.

"According to long-term indicators, this air temperature corresponds to April 2," the observatory noted.
